예제 #1
0
 def decode(self, sessiondict):
     return dict((k, Store.decode(self, v) if isinstance(v, Binary)
                  and v.subtype == USER_DEFINED_SUBTYPE else v)
                 for (k, v) in list(sessiondict.items()))
예제 #2
0
 def decode(self, sessiondict):
     return dict((k, Store.decode(self, v) if type(v) is Binary else v)
                 for (k, v) in sessiondict.iteritems())
예제 #3
0
 def encode(self, sessiondict):
     return dict((k, Binary(Store.encode(self, v), USER_DEFINED_SUBTYPE
                            ) if needs_encode(v) else v)
                 for (k, v) in list(sessiondict.items()))
예제 #4
0
 def encode(self, sessiondict):
     return dict((k, Binary(Store.encode(self, v)) if needs_encode(v) else v)
                 for (k, v) in sessiondict.iteritems())
예제 #5
0
 def encode(self, sessiondict):
     return dict(
         (k, Binary(Store.encode(self, v)) if needs_encode(v) else v)
         for (k, v) in sessiondict.iteritems())
예제 #6
0
 def decode(self, sessiondict):
     return dict((k, Store.decode(self, v) if isinstance(v, Binary) else v)
                 for (k, v) in sessiondict.iteritems())
예제 #7
0
파일: session.py 프로젝트: taras1k/blog
 def decode(self, sessiondict):
     return dict((k, Store.decode(self, v) if type(v) is Binary else v)
         for (k, v) in sessiondict.iteritems())
예제 #8
0
 def decode(self, sessiondict):
     return dict((k, Store.decode(self, v) if isinstance(v, Binary) and v.subtype == USER_DEFINED_SUBTYPE else v)
                 for (k, v) in sessiondict.items())
예제 #9
0
 def encode(self, sessiondict):
     return dict((k, Binary(Store.encode(self, v), USER_DEFINED_SUBTYPE) if needs_encode(v) else v)
                 for (k, v) in sessiondict.items())
예제 #10
0
 def decode(self, sessiondict):
     return dict((k, Store.decode(self, v) if isinstance(v, Binary) else v)
                 for (k, v) in sessiondict.iteritems())